lua: Add ability to pass tables with __call
vim-patch:8.2.1054: not so easy to pass a lua function to Vim vim-patch:8.2.1084: Lua: registering function has useless code I think I have also opened up the possibility for people to use these callbacks elsewhere, since I've added a new struct that we should be able to use. Also, this should allow us to determine what the state of a list is in Lua or a dictionary in Lua, since we now can track the luaref as we go.
